In the context of U.S. electoral politics, the outcome of elections can be influenced by various factors related to voter behavior. Political scientists analyze voter demographics, psychological factors, and societal influences to understand voting patterns. One significant concept is the 'sociological model of voting behavior', which suggests that voters make decisions based on their social characteristics.
